Common noise types in Lucas, TX and likely causes
- Knocking or tapping (engine): low oil, worn rod or main bearings, carbon buildup causing detonation (more likely in extreme summer heat).
- Pinging or spark knock: incorrect fuel, timing issues, or lower octane fuel — heat increases risk of detonation.
- Loud exhaust roar or ticking: cracked exhaust manifold, loose heat shield, failing muffler or rusted pipe (humidity and road salt accelerate corrosion).
- Grinding or squealing when braking: worn pads, glazed rotors, stuck caliper, or debris caught between pad and rotor — stop-and-go commutes increase wear.
- Humming or growling from wheel area: worn wheel bearings, tire cupping, or alignment issues from rough rural roads.
- Clunking on bumps or during shifts: worn suspension bushings, control arms, struts, or drivetrain U-joints/CV joints.
- Whining during acceleration: failing transmission pump, worn belt-driven accessory (power steering, alternator), or supercharger/transmission concerns.
- Intermittent squeaks or rattles: loose trim, heat shields, or small hardware — common after driving on rough country roads.
What the noise diagnosis process includes
- Symptom intake and history
- Technician records when the noise occurs (idle, acceleration, braking, turning), frequency, recent repairs, and driving conditions (gravel roads, towing, heavy heat). This often pinpoints likely systems before inspection.
- Road test and listening checks
- A controlled road test replicates the sound while the technician evaluates speed/load/steering inputs. Multiple passes help separate road, wind and mechanical noises.
- Targeted static inspections under lift
- Visual and tactile checks of engine mounts, belts, pulleys, exhaust, brake components, suspension, wheel bearings, CV joints and driveshafts. Corrosion and worn rubber parts are common on local roads and are inspected carefully.
- Diagnostic tools and techniques
- Scan tool: reads stored fault codes, freeze frame data and sensor readings that coincide with noise events.
- Mechanic’s stethoscope: isolates ticking or knocking to a specific valve, bearing, or accessory.
- Borescope: inspects internal engine areas (valves, pistons) or inside exhaust components without disassembly.
- Lift and hands-on tests: wheel play, rotor runout, and suspension articulation checks.
- Load tests and simulated conditions: running engine under load or applying brakes to reproduce noises safely.
- Documentation and next-step recommendations
- A detailed inspection report outlines findings, severity, repair options, parts needed, labor time and estimated costs so you can choose whether to repair now or monitor.
Typical diagnostic fees and timelines
- Diagnostic fees vary by complexity; expect a basic noise diagnosis and road test to be in the range of $75–$150. More intensive diagnostics (extended road testing, borescope inspection, or engine tear-down) can increase the fee.
- Standard diagnosis timeline: 1–3 hours for common issues. Complex or intermittent noises that require extended road testing or disassembly can take 1–2 days.
- Most shops apply the diagnostic fee toward repair if you proceed, but policies vary; final confirmation follows the initial inspection.
Common repair options with estimated cost ranges
(Each vehicle and diagnosis is unique; these ranges reflect typical local repair costs.)
- Wheel bearing replacement: $200–$500 per wheel.
- Brake pads and resurfacing rotors: $150–$400 per axle; full rotor replacement $250–$600 per axle.
- Exhaust repair (patch, clamp, muffler): $150–$600; manifold or catalytic converter repairs are higher.
- Suspension components (struts, control arms, bushings): $300–$1,200 depending on parts and labor.
- Belt, pulley, or accessory replacement: $100–$500.
- Engine repairs for knocking (bearing or internal): can range from $1,000 for selective repairs to several thousand for major engine work.
- Transmission or drivetrain repairs: $800–$4,000 depending on extent.
Final written estimates follow the diagnosis so you know exactly what’s required and why.

Urgent vs non-urgent sounds — how to prioritize
- Urgent (bring vehicle in immediately or stop driving): loud metal grinding, loud knocking from the engine, burning smell with smoke, sudden loss of power, or noises accompanied by dashboard warnings. These can indicate imminent component failure or safety hazards.
- Important but not immediate: persistent grinding when braking, steady humming from a wheel, new clunks when turning. Schedule diagnosis within a few days to prevent escalation.
- Monitorable (can wait a short time): minor intermittent rattles, small trim squeaks, or wind noise. Still document conditions so a technician can replicate the symptom.
